Legal Consultant Wills, Trusts & LPAs (Admin Focused)
Location: London-based with regional travel
Salary: £28,000 £30,000 + Commission
Contract: Full-Time, Permanent
Hours: Monday to Thursday 9am6pm, Friday 9am5pm (39 hrs/week)
Start Date: Within 4 weeks

How to prepare for a job interview at Minerva Recruitment Limited

✨Show Your Administrative Skills

As the role is admin-focused, be prepared to discuss your organisational skills and any relevant experience. Highlight specific examples where you've successfully managed tasks or projects, demonstrating your ability to handle administrative duties effectively.

✨Understand Wills and Trusts Basics

Familiarise yourself with the fundamentals of wills, trusts, and lasting powers of attorney. This knowledge will not only show your interest in the field but also help you answer questions confidently and engage in meaningful discussions during the interview.

✨Demonstrate Client-Facing Experience

Since the position requires a confident, client-facing professional, prepare to share experiences where you've interacted with clients. Discuss how you handled inquiries, resolved issues, or provided excellent service, showcasing your communication skills and professionalism.

✨Ask Insightful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ions about the company and the role. Inquire about their approach to client service, team dynamics, or opportunities for professional development.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
